Based on interviews and site visits with twelve Baldrige National Quality Award-winning companies as well as with two winners of the President's Quality and Productivity Award. A complete guide for implementing total quality management (TQM) in all organizations. Lessons learned by leading TQM companies will help managers and executives assess an organization's readiness for TQM and prepare for the cultural revolution required to truly embrace quality. An excellent primer on the most important subject for American business in the 1900's--training its people. --James Flannigan, Business columnist, Los Angeles Times

WARREN H. SCHMIDT is professor emeritus of public administration at the University of Southern California. JEROME P.
